Residential Tenancies Board - Citizens Information

WebIf you are renting a self-contained flat or apartment in your landlord’s home, your tenancy is covered by residential tenancies legislation and your landlord must register it with the Residential Tenancies Board. However, if you are renting a room that is part of your landlord's home, your tenancy is not covered by this legislation. Web11 Answers. There is a much easier way! WebAug 12, 2024 · Registration of a tenancy may be completed online on rtb.ie Alternatively, you can download the registration form (RTB1) from the RTB website and post to …

WebThe basic fee for registering a private rented, student-specific or cost rental tenancy with the RTB is €40 per year. The fee to register an AHB tenancy is €20 a year.
